Ingredients

Ingredient Quantities and Details

Ingredient Quantity Notes
All-Bran cereal 2 cups Provides fiber and texture. Use the original Jumbo variety for best results.
Raisins 1 cup Natural sweetness; consider soaking in warm water briefly if they are dry.
Unsalted butter 1/2 cup (113 grams) Softened for easy creaming.
Sugar 1 cup (200 grams) Granulated sugar preferred.
Egg 1 large Room temperature for better emulsification.
All-purpose flour 2 cups (240 grams) Can substitute with whole wheat or gluten-free flour.
Baking powder 1 teaspoon Leavening agent for lightness.
Cinnamon 1 teaspoon Warm spice for flavor depth.
Nutmeg 1/2 teaspoon Freshly grated if possible.
Cloves Pinch Optional, enhances spice profile.

Instructions

Step 1: Prepping Your Workspace and Ingredients

Begin by gathering all ingredients and equipment. Preheat your oven to 350°F (180°C). Line baking sheets with parchment paper or silicone mats to prevent sticking and ensure even baking. Measure out all ingredients carefully, especially when baking, as precision impacts the final outcome.

Step 2: Creaming Butter and Sugar

In a large mixing bowl, add the softened butter and sugar. Using an electric mixer or a sturdy whisk, cream the mixture on medium speed until it becomes pale, fluffy, and well-incorporated, approximately 2-3 minutes. This process is crucial as it introduces air into the mixture, helping the cookies rise and develop a tender crumb.

Step 3: Incorporating the Egg and Spices

Add the egg to the creamed mixture and beat until fully blended. This aids in binding the ingredients together and contributes to the cookie’s structure. Then, add the cinnamon, nutmeg, and a pinch of cloves. Mix on low speed or by hand until the spices are evenly distributed, releasing their aromatic oils into the dough.

Step 4: Combining Dry Ingredients

In a separate bowl, whisk together the flour and baking powder. Gradually add this dry mixture in three portions to the wet ingredients, mixing on low speed or by hand after each addition. This incremental incorporation prevents flour from flying out of the bowl and ensures a smooth, uniform dough.

Step 5: Folding in All-Bran and Raisins

Gently fold in the All-Bran cereal and raisins using a spatula or wooden spoon. Be careful not to overmix, as the cereal can break down if handled too vigorously. The cereal adds chewiness and fiber, while the raisins contribute natural sweetness and moistness. Ensure they are evenly distributed throughout the dough.

Step 6: Portioning and Shaping the Cookies

Using a cookie scoop or tablespoon, portion out the dough onto the prepared baking sheets. Leave adequate space—at least 2 inches—between each cookie to allow for spreading during baking. For uniformity, you can roll the dough into balls or shape them into flat discs depending on your preference.

Step 7: Baking

Place the baking sheets in the preheated oven. Bake for approximately 10-12 minutes, or until the edges are golden brown and the centers look set but still soft. The cookies will firm up as they cool, so avoid overbaking to maintain their chewiness.

Step 8: Cooling and Serving

Remove the cookies from the oven and transfer them carefully to a cooling rack. Allow them to cool for about 10 minutes to set their structure and enhance flavor. Serve warm or at room temperature, accompanied by tea, coffee, or milk.

Preparation Tips

  • Use room temperature ingredients: Ensures better emulsification and a smooth dough.
  • Adjust spice levels: For a milder flavor, reduce the amount of cinnamon or nutmeg. For a more intense spice profile, increase slightly.
  • Soften raisins: Soaking raisins in warm water for 10 minutes can prevent them from drawing moisture from the dough, keeping the cookies tender.
  • Experiment with add-ins: Chopped nuts, dried cranberries, or chocolate chips can be incorporated for variety.
  • Cookie size: Larger cookies will need slightly longer baking time; adjust accordingly.

Tips and Tricks

  • Don’t overmix: Gentle folding preserves the integrity of the cereal and raisins, ensuring a chewy texture.
  • For crispier cookies: Slightly flatten the dough before baking or extend baking time by a minute or two.
  • Enhance flavor: Add a splash of vanilla extract or orange zest for extra aroma.
  • Keep dough chilled: For thicker, chewier cookies, refrigerate the dough for 30 minutes before baking.
  • Uniform cookies: Use a cookie scoop for consistent size, ensuring even baking across batches.

Add-ons and Variations

  • Chocolate Chips: Incorporate 1/2 cup of semi-sweet or dark chocolate chips for a decadent twist.
  • Nuts: Chopped walnuts, pecans, or almonds add crunch and flavor.
  • Spice Adjustments: Add a pinch of ginger or allspice for more complexity.
  • Sweeteners: Substitute part of the sugar with honey or maple syrup for a natural sweetness and moistness.

Improvements and Customizations

  • Gluten-Free Version: Replace all-purpose flour with a gluten-free blend and ensure cereal is gluten-free.
  • Vegan Version: Swap butter for coconut oil or vegan margarine and eggs for flaxseed or chia seed gel (1 tbsp ground flaxseed + 3 tbsp water).
  • Lower Sugar: Reduce sugar to 3/4 cup or use natural sweeteners like stevia or erythritol, adjusting baking times as needed.
  • Extra Nutrition: Incorporate ground flaxseed, chia seeds, or wheat germ into the dough.

Save and Store

Allow baked cookies to cool completely, then store in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 5 days. For longer storage, freeze cookies in a sealed bag or container for up to 3 months. To reheat, warm briefly in the microwave or oven for a fresh-baked feel.

FAQ

Can I use other cereals instead of All-Bran?

Yes, you can experiment with bran flakes, oat bran, or shredded wheat as substitutes, but keep in mind that texture and fiber content will vary.

Can I make these cookies gluten-free?

Absolutely. Use a certified gluten-free flour blend and check that raisins and cereal are gluten-free to ensure the entire recipe is suitable for gluten sensitivities.

How do I make these cookies vegan?

Replace butter with plant-based margarine or coconut oil. Use flaxseed or chia seed gel instead of eggs. Adjust baking time if necessary, as vegan fats can alter baking properties.

Can I add nuts or chocolate chips?

Certainly! Mix in 1/2 to 1 cup of chopped nuts or chocolate chips into the dough before baking for added flavor and texture.
